Invalid Restrictive Covenants in Health Care
Summary
Invalid Restrictive Covenants in Health Care; Specifies certain restrictive covenants in employment agreements between physicians & hospitals do not support legitimate business interest; authorizes party to employment agreement to elect to have mutually agreed upon arbitrator make specified binding determination.
